This Program Support Assistant Office Automation (OA) position is located at the Audie L. Murphy VA Medical Center within Social Work Service (SWS).

To qualify for this position, applicants must meet all requirements by the closing date of this announcement, 04/02/2026.

Time-In-Grade Requirement: Applicants who are current Federal employees and have held a GS grade any time in the past 52 weeks must also meet time-in-grade requirements by the closing date of this announcement.

For a GS-06 position you must have served 52 weeks at the GS-05. The grade may have been in any occupation, but must have been held in the Federal service.

An SF-50 that shows your time-in-grade eligibility must be submitted with your application materials.

If the most recent SF-50 has an effective date within the past year, it may not clearly demonstrate you possess one-year time-in-grade, as required by the announcement.

In this instance, you must provide an additional SF-50 that clearly demonstrates one-year time-in-grade.

Note: Time-In-Grade requirements also apply to former Federal employees applying for reinstatement as well as current employees applying for Veterans Employment Opportunities Act of 1998 (VEOA) appointment.

You may qualify based on your experience as described below: Specialized Experience: You must have one year of specialized experience equivalent to at least the next lower grade GS-05 in the normal line of progression for the occupation in the organization.

Examples of specialized experience would typically include, but are not limited to: Knowledge of medical terminology and usages, spelling, grammar, and composition; Ability to perform, plan and organize work; Skill in use of Microsoft Work, Outlook, and Excel programs, scheduling; Statistical and analytical processes and deductive reasoning to conduct problem and trend identification and resolution; Skill in applying basic data gathering methods, such as standard interviewing or surveying techniques, to collect various types of factual information.

Major Duties:

Duties may include but are not limited to: -Uses Microsoft Excel or other comparable spreadsheet software to develop and change spreadsheets in order to graphically display data.

-Uses Microsoft Word or comparable word processing software to execute several office automation functions such as storing and retrieving electronic documents and files; inserting and deleting text formatting letters, reports and memoranda.

-Utilizing Microsoft PowerPoint, Microsoft Publisher, or comparable software the PSA (OA) prepares materials for publications such as pamphlets, forms, graphs, or technical manuals.

-Functions as a timekeeper and documents SWS staff time and leave as required following STVHCS policy and national regulation.

-Uses the Veterans Health Information and Technology Architecture (VISTA) to access and compile information.

-Performs work related to the acquisition and development of program information and resource materials/personnel to support the policy development and technical activities of the organization.

-Serves as an Automated Data Processing Application Coordinator (ADPAC) to support SWS staff in the acquisition of equipment such as telephones, computers, printers, fax machines, laptops, cellular phones, tablets from the Office of Information Technology (OIT).

-Functions as an alternate travel arranger utilizing the federal travel program to assist SWS staff with travel orders, including travel vouchers and authorizations.

-Performs proficient clerical and administrative support, ensuring appropriate administrative processes are maintained in SWS. -Receives calls and routes callers, patients, and visitors.

-Maintains calendars, schedules appointments, coordinates meetings, and schedules conferences between various SWS program staff and all staff disciplines throughout the STVHCS.
